The Information Asymmetry Trap
The problem isn't just a lack of vocabulary; it's Information Asymmetry. In any complex transaction, the party with the specialized knowledge holds all the cards. When you don't know the difference between a "Progress Payment" and "Retainage," or how a "Mechanic's Lien" can affect your home's title, you're at a massive disadvantage.
Up until now, homeowners were expected to learn these lessons the hard way – usually through expensive mistakes, "after-the-fact" regret, or confusing legal disputes. You were forced to be the "Project Manager by default" without a single tool to help you translate the process.
